When deciding whether to incorporate hyaluronic acid (HA) into your morning or nighttime skincare routine, several factors come into play that can influence its effectiveness and overall benefit to your skin. Hyaluronic acid is a humectant known for its extraordinary ability to attract and bind moisture, significantly boosting hydration levels. However, the timing of its application can subtly impact how this ingredient performs, and tailoring its use can optimize results based on individual needs and circumstances.
Applying hyaluronic acid in the morning can be advantageous, especially given its lightweight texture and hydrating properties that create a smooth, supple base for makeup application. In a sense, HA primes the skin by locking in moisture and promoting a radiant, dewy complexion that lasts throughout the day. When layered correctly-typically on damp skin followed by a moisturizer and sunscreen-hyaluronic acid helps maintain skin hydration against daily environmental stressors like pollution and dry air. This makes it a particularly appealing choice for those living in arid or air-conditioned environments that can sap moisture from the skin. Morning use also caters well to people with combination or oily skin who prefer lighter, refreshing products to avoid heaviness during the day.
Conversely, nighttime application offers a unique advantage by aligning with the skin’s natural repair and regenerative processes. While the skin undergoes restorative functions overnight, applying hyaluronic acid can enhance moisture retention and support barrier repair in a lower humidity environment, potentially allowing for deeper penetration and improved effectiveness. Pairing HA with richer night creams or serums can also provide sustained hydration and help combat dryness, which tends to be more pronounced as we sleep. For those with dry or mature skin, nighttime use might be critical in restoring moisture and resilience.
Skin type, climate, and personal lifestyle further influence the decision. For instance, a person with dry, sensitive skin in a cold climate may benefit from twice-daily use, combining morning hydration with nighttime repair. Meanwhile, someone with oily skin in a humid environment might prefer a morning-only application to avoid excessive greasiness. Ultimately, personal preference regarding texture, routine simplicity, and whether you wear makeup can sway the choice.
In essence, an individualized approach to hyaluronic acid use-considering one’s unique skin needs, environment, and lifestyle-will yield the best outcomes.
